The cone crusher is a modified gyratory crusher and accordingly many of the same terms including gape set and throw apply The essential difference is that the shorter spindle of the cone crusher is not suspended as in the gyratory but is supported in a curved universal bearing below the gyratory head or cone Figure Major suppliers of cone crushers include Metso

The calculated nip angles were validated against those obtained from physical measurements during actual roll compaction These nip angles were in agreement for various powder formulations containing plastic and brittle materials The nip angles ranged from 4° to 12° and decreased significantly when the proportion of brittle material increased
